Mexico does beach luxury in a thousand different ways, but Punta Mita is in a category of its own. This private peninsula in the Riviera Nayarit, just north of Puerto Vallarta, pairs gated exclusivity with a relaxed, sun-soaked rhythm. Think white-sand beaches that cool your feet at dawn, warm water that’s often swimmable year-round, and days that can be as active (golf, surf, snorkeling) or as slow (pool, spa, beach club lunches) as you want.
Punta Mita is built for effortless high-end travel. You'll find pristine beaches, a marina, standout dining, and two Jack Nicklaus Signature golf courses, plus easy access to ocean experiences like snorkeling, surfing, and seasonal whale watching. A valid passport is required for travel to Mexico. Many travelers can enter as tourists without a visa depending on nationality and length of stay, but requirements vary—confirm entry rules before you book flights.
Most travelers fly into Puerto Vallarta's airport (PVR) and continue by car or private transfer. The drive to Punta Mita is typically around 45–60 minutes depending on traffic and your exact community. Your Concierge can arrange airport transfers and transportation for the full stay.
It depends on your travel style. Many guests rely on private drivers arranged by their Concierge, especially for dinners or day trips. Within the gated community, golf carts are common, and some residences include one. A car is helpful if you plan to explore beyond Punta Mita frequently.
Top experiences include golf on the Jack Nicklaus Signature courses, beach club days, surfing and paddleboarding, snorkeling, and seasonal whale watching. Many travelers also book boat days to explore the coastline and nearby islands, then return to the villa for sunset dinners and pool time.

Punta Mita is a gated, resort-style peninsula built around privacy, beach clubs, and high-end amenities. Puerto Vallarta is a larger city with a vibrant restaurant scene, nightlife, and a more urban-meets-beach feel. Travelers who want a quieter, more exclusive home base often choose Punta Mita, while those who want to be closer to the energy and culture of town may prefer Puerto Vallarta.
The most popular season is typically late fall through spring for sunny days and comfortable evenings. Summer is warmer and can feel quieter, with seasonal weather patterns to keep in mind. Your Villa Specialist can help match dates to the experience you want.
